South American beauty with multicolored flowers (yellow, peach and apricot) and dark black-green foliage.

Also called 'Lily of the Incas'. Flower symbolizes friendship, individual petals symbolize understanding, humour, patience, empathy, commitment and respect.

Premium cut flower and hardy to zone 6.

Plants are slighly poisonous to animals, but deer browsing was reported - so protect it from the deer.

Blooming time: mid summer to late summer
Size: 3-3.5' tall x 2-3' wide clumps
USDA zones: 6 to 9, in zone 6 plant in sheltered position and winter protection is benefitial. Fully hardy in drained soils (without protection)
Culture: sun, half shade, average soil, clay loam soil, loam, drained soils - likes higher content of organic material (amend with compost, old manure). Neutral to slightly acidic soils are the best. Drained soil increase hardiness
Moisture Needs: medium
Origin:  garden hybrid, part of Proven Winners program
Deer/rabbit resistant: no/most likely yes
Attracts Butterflies or Pollinators: bees, butterflies
Attracts Hummingbirds: yes

Plant combinations : Easy to grow. Goes well with majority of common perennials, preferably with those that appreciate good soil with more nutrients (more organic matter) like Astilbe (in halfshade), Baptisia, hardy Geraniums, Hemerocallis, Iris, Paeonia, tall Phlox and hybrids, Rudbeckia, taller Veronica, Veronicastrum, or with grasses like Panicum virgatum or Pennisetum (where not invasive).
